2008 Tata Indigo vs. 1984 Vauxhall Astra

To start off, 2008 Tata Indigo is newer by 24 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Vauxhall Astra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Vauxhall Astra would be higher. At 1,405 cc (4 cylinders), 2008 Tata Indigo is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Tata Indigo weights approximately 306 kg more than 1984 Vauxhall Astra.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Tata Indigo (120 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 31 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 Vauxhall Astra. (89 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2008 Tata Indigo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 Vauxhall Astra.
